Engine Specifications and Options

The 2013 Chevrolet Equinox offers two robust engine options‚ designed to deliver a balance of power and efficiency. The standard engine is a 2.4-liter Ecotec four-cylinder‚ which produces 182 horsepower and 172 lb-ft of torque. This engine is known for its fuel efficiency‚ achieving an EPA-estimated 22 mpg in the city and 32 mpg on the highway‚ making it an excellent choice for drivers prioritizing economy without sacrificing performance.

For those seeking more power‚ the available 3.6-liter V6 engine is a standout option. This engine delivers 301 horsepower and 272 lb-ft of torque‚ providing a thrilling driving experience. The V6 model also boasts a maximum towing capacity of up to 3‚500 pounds‚ making it ideal for drivers who need to tow small trailers or boats. Both engines are paired with a smooth-shifting six-speed automatic transmission‚ ensuring responsive acceleration and seamless gear changes.

The 2.4-liter engine is equipped with direct fuel injection and variable valve timing‚ which enhance fuel efficiency and performance; Additionally‚ the Equinox features an Eco mode that helps optimize fuel economy by adjusting transmission shift points and throttle response. This feature is particularly beneficial for city driving or long road trips where fuel savings are a priority.

Both engine options are available with either front-wheel drive (FWD) or all-wheel drive (AWD). The AWD system provides improved traction and stability‚ especially in inclement weather or off-road conditions‚ making it a practical choice for drivers who encounter varied terrain.

Trim Levels and Features

The 2013 Chevrolet Equinox is available in four distinct trim levels: LS‚ LT‚ LTZ‚ and 2LT. Each trim is designed to cater to different preferences and needs‚ offering a range of features that enhance comfort‚ convenience‚ and performance. Whether you prioritize affordability‚ luxury‚ or advanced technology‚ there’s an Equinox trim to suit your lifestyle.

The base LS trim provides essential amenities for a comfortable driving experience. It includes features such as air conditioning‚ a tilt-adjustable steering wheel‚ and a basic audio system with four speakers. The LS also comes with keyless entry and a rearview camera‚ ensuring safety and convenience. While it may lack some of the premium features found in higher trims‚ the LS remains a practical choice for budget-conscious buyers.

The LT trim builds on the LS by adding more convenience and technology features. It includes upgrades like a premium audio system with eight speakers‚ Bluetooth connectivity‚ and Chevrolet’s MyLink infotainment system. The LT also features cruise control‚ a leather-wrapped steering wheel‚ and 17-inch aluminum wheels. Optional packages for the LT allow buyers to add features like a navigation system‚ rear park assist‚ and a power liftgate‚ providing greater flexibility.

The LTZ trim represents the top-of-the-line option‚ offering a luxurious experience. It includes all the features of the LT plus premium leather-appointed seating‚ heated front seats‚ and a remote vehicle starter system. The LTZ also boasts chrome exterior accents‚ fog lamps‚ and 18-inch chrome-clad aluminum wheels‚ giving it a sophisticated appearance. Additional features like a programmable power liftgate and a dual-zone automatic climate control system further enhance comfort and convenience.

The 2LT trim serves as a mid-level option‚ bridging the gap between the LT and LTZ. It includes many of the LTZ’s premium features‚ such as leather seating surfaces and heated front seats‚ while maintaining a more affordable price point. The 2LT also offers a range of optional upgrades‚ allowing buyers to customize their vehicle to their preferences.

The ignition system is straightforward‚ with three modes: ACCESSORY‚ ON‚ and START. To start the engine‚ insert the key into the ignition‚ turn it to the START position‚ and release it immediately once the engine begins to run. The manual also emphasizes the importance of wearing seat belts and ensuring all passengers are properly restrained before moving the vehicle.

Operating the transmission is simple‚ with clear instructions for shifting between PARK‚ REVERSE‚ NEUTRAL‚ DRIVE‚ and MANUAL modes. The manual advises drivers to come to a complete stop before shifting from REVERSE or NEUTRAL to DRIVE. It also highlights the importance of using the brake pedal when shifting out of PARK to ensure safe operation.

The instrument panel is designed to keep you informed about your vehicle’s status. The manual explains how to interpret the gauges‚ warning lights‚ and indicators. For example‚ the Malfunction Indicator Lamp (MIL) illuminates if the vehicle detects an issue with the emissions system. The Driver Information Center (DIC) provides additional details about your trip‚ fuel efficiency‚ and maintenance needs.
